Comprehending the IELTS Exam

Before diving into the alternatives, it's necessary to comprehend what the IELTS exam involves. IELTS evaluates a candidate's ability to communicate in English across 4 crucial locations: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The test is offered in two form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format is generally required for college and expert registration, while the General Training format is utilized for work and migration purposes.

Scholarships and Financial Aid

Among the most effective ways to decrease the cost of the IELTS exam is through scholarships and monetary help. Lots of universities, governments, and non-profit companies use scholarships that cover or partially cover the exam costs. Here are some actions to explore these opportunities:

  1. University Scholarships:

    • Check with the universities you are applying to. Many institutions provide monetary support to international trainees, which can include IELTS exam costs.
    • Look for particular scholarship programs for language efficiency tests.
  2. Government Grants:

    • Explore government programs and grants in your home country. Some federal governments use financial assistance to trainees planning to study abroad.
    • Research international help programs that support education and language learning.
  3. Non-Profit Organizations:

    • Organizations like the British Council, Fulbright, and the United Nations often have scholarship programs that can assist cover the expense of standardized tests, including IELTS.
    • Search for local NGOs that concentrate on education and language training.

Alternative Language Proficiency Tests

For those who discover the IELTS exam expense expensive, there are alternative language proficiency tests that might be accepted by the organizations or organizations they are applying to. These tests frequently have lower fees or more versatile pricing options:

  1. T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language):

    • TOEFL is another commonly accepted English language test. The fees are generally lower than IELTS, varying from ₤ 180 to ₤ 250.
    • Some universities and organizations accept TOEFL scores in place of IELTS.
  2. PTE (Pearson Test of English):

    • PTE is a computer-based test that is accepted by numerous universities and migration authorities. The costs are normally lower than IELTS, around ₤ 195.
    • PTE offers more frequent test dates and faster outcomes, which can be beneficial for time-sensitive applications.
  3. Cambridge English Exams:

    • Cambridge uses a series of English language examinations, such as the Cambridge English: Advanced (CAE) and Cambridge English: Proficiency (CPE). These exams are frequently acknowledged by universities and companies.
